See detailsWhat we get called for in Cape Coral
Older neighbourhoods around Cape Coral still have cast iron and galvanized in the ground, and those lines scale, split and root up. Newer subdivisions are almost all slab-on-grade, which hides supply leaks until the water bill or a warm patch of floor gives it away.

Can you find a leak without breaking up my floor?
That is the point of proper leak detection. We isolate the meter to confirm the leak is on your side, then use acoustic listening and thermal imaging to narrow it down before anything is opened. The goal is a small, marked opening rather than an exploratory demolition.

What should I do while I wait for the plumber?
For an active leak, shut off the water. Most Cape Coral homes have a main shut-off near the meter at the street or on the wall where the service line enters. For a single fixture, use the small valve behind it. If you cannot find either, stay on the line and our dispatcher will talk you through it.
